Microsoft Mulai Menyediakan DirectX Shader Compiler Linux Binaries

  • Post author:
  • Post category:Linux

Pada awal 2017 Microsoft membuka-sumber kompiler shader DirectX mereka dan tidak lama kemudian dimungkinkan untuk membangunnya di Linux sementara akhirnya pada minggu ini Microsoft telah mulai menyediakan binari Linux resmi dari kompiler shader mereka.
Dirilis pada hari Sabtu adalah DirectXShaderCompiler v1.7.2212 sebagai rilis kompiler DX “Desember 2022”. Selain sekarang termasuk dukungan penuh HLSL 2021 untuk generasi SPIR-V dan berbagai flag compiler baru, ini menandai pertama kalinya mereka menyertakan binari Linux lengkap sebagai bagian dari rilis.
Catatan rilis menyebutkan:
Binari Linux sekarang disertakan. Ini termasuk kompiler yang dapat dieksekusi, pustaka dinamis, dan pustaka penandatanganan dxil…Untuk pertama kalinya paket ini juga menyertakan versi Linux dari kompiler dengan executable yang sesuai, libdxcompiler.so, header, dan libdxil.so untuk platform x64. Ini tidak ada manfaat nyata bagi pengguna akhir Linux. Seperti yang disebutkan, sudah mungkin untuk mengkompilasi kompiler shader DirectX untuk Linux sementara sekarang mereka menyediakan binari resmi. Sebelum ada yang terlalu bersemangat, ini tidak mendapatkan Direct3D 12 di Linux secara asli, ganti VKD3D-Proton, atau apa pun di sepanjang garis itu – ini hanya kompiler shader DirectX. DirectXShaderCompiler di Linux dapat berguna untuk pengembang dalam kasus konversi SPIR-V untuk shader, mengkompilasi shader HLSL ke DXIL di Linux, digunakan oleh Mesa sebagai bagian dari pekerjaan D3D12 mereka untuk memanfaatkan penggunaan Subsistem Windows untuk Linux (WSL2), dan pengembang serupa jalan untuk interoperabilitas yang lebih baik.

Mereka yang tertarik dapat menemukan rilis DirectX Shader Compiler Microsoft yang baru dengan binari Linux sekarang di belakangnya melalui GitHub.

Itulah berita seputar Microsoft Mulai Menyediakan DirectX Shader Compiler Linux Binaries, semoga bermanfaat. Disadur dari Phoronix.com.